**The Opportunity**:
The Department of Parliamentary Services (DPS) is recruiting for a Parliamentary Service Level 6 Emergency Management Advisor within Security Operations Branch. This role is an excellent opportunity for a proactive individual to contribute to a high-performing, practical and strategically aligned security function.
You will play a key part in supporting security objectives through expert advice, effectively delivering physical lockdown and evacuation exercises and strong stakeholder engagement. You will be trusted to manage sensitive issues, drive business improvement initiatives and lead key components of our operational security responsibilities.
This position requires sound judgement, solid organisational and planning skills, with the ability to work independently while contributing to broader team and organisational objectives. You will be required to occasionally work outside normal business hours.
If you are looking to step into a leadership role and make a meaningful impact in security, this could be your next move.
**Who we are looking for**:
To succeed in this role, you will:
- Plan, coordinate and deliver physical lockdown and evacuation exercises
- Liaise with internal and external stakeholders, including planning exercises and managing sensitivity with professionalism
- Lead by example and contribute to team cohesion, setting priorities and maintaining high standards of service delivery
- Provide accurate and timely advice, prepare briefings, procedural documentation and reporting on security matters to support informed decision-making
- Conduct internal audits, risk assessments and assurance activities to identify areas for improvement and support continuous improvement initiatives
- Stay adaptable and solutions-focused while supporting operational and organisational needs
**Job Specific Requirements**
- The successful applicant will be required to obtain and maintain a Negative Vetting 1 (Confidential/Highly Protected/Secret) security clearance.
**Duty Statement**:
**Classification**:Parliamentary Service Level 6
**Branch**:Security Operations Branch
**Section**:Security Operations Support
**Immediate supervisor**:Assistant Director, Security Delivery and Capability
Under limited/general direction undertake duties in accordance with the agreed standards for the Parliamentary Service Level 6 classification. The duties will include, but are not limited to, the following:
- Liaise with internal and external stakeholders, including senior executives, to facilitate multi-agency emergency preparedness exercises.
- Prepare briefs, internal communications, policies & procedures, after-action reviews and other relevant documents in line APH Emergency Management Governance frameworks.
- Ensure the delivery of quality results, including the development of specialist professional and/or technical expertise. Conduct regular quality assurance of processes and manage identified risks.
- Maintain awareness of longer-term strategic and operational objectives in alignment with Emergency and Security Governance arrangements.
- Provide specialist expertise and technical knowledge in Emergency Management across a range of programs and platforms including training, preparedness and physical security.
- Employees of DPS are required to be able, and to be seen to be able, to provide professional advice and services to all Senators and Members without favour or prejudice._
